2020 (12) TMI 1383 - SC ORDEROffence under SEBI - imposition of disgorgement - appellants are prohibited from dealing in equity derivatives in F&O segment of Stock Exchanges - Appellant no. 1 shall disgorge an amount of Rs 447.27 Crs alongwith interest @12% p.a. w.e.f. 29.11.2017 onwards till the date of payment - HELD THAT:- Securities Appellate Tribunal has recoded a split verdict, with a dissent by its Chairperson. Having regard to the issues raised, we admit the appeal against the order of the Securities Appellate Tribunal dated 5 November 2020. Insofar as the interim relief is concerned, the appellants have complied with the order for debarment from dealing in equity derivatives for one year, imposed by the Whole Time Member of SEBI. The appellants have been directed to make payment of the disgorged amount of Rs 447.27 crores along with simple interest at the rate of 12% per annum with effect from 29 November 2007 till payment. As and by way of interim relief, we order and direct that the appellants shall, within a period of four weeks from today, deposit an amount of Rs 250 crores in the Investors’ Protection Fund in compliance with the order of the Whole Time Member, subject to the final result of the appeal. There shall be a stay on the recovery of the balance, inclusive of interest, pending the appeal.
